Convert Cubic Foot to Liter

Conversion Formula for Cubic Foot to Liter

The formula of conversion of Cubic Foot to Liter is very simple. To convert Cubic Foot to Liter, we can use this simple formula:

1 Cubic Foot = 28.3168 Liter

1 Liter = 0.0353147248 Cubic Foot

One Cubic Foot is equal to 28.3168 Liter. So, we need to multiply the number of Cubic Foot by 28.3168 to get the no of Liter. This formula helps when we need to change the measurements from Cubic Foot to Liter

Details for Cubic Foot (Customary Volume)

Introduction : The cubic foot represents the volume of a cube with 1-foot edges, equal to about 28.3 liters. It's widely used in construction, refrigeration, and shipping industries where measurements based on foot dimensions are practical.

History & Origin : Evolved naturally from linear foot measurements in English customary units. Became standardized as part of the imperial system. Remains important in countries using feet for linear measurements despite metric alternatives.

Current Use : Common for measuring refrigerator/freezer capacity, natural gas consumption, and building materials. Used in shipping for container volume calculations. Standard unit for measuring airflow (cubic feet per minute) in HVAC systems.

Details for Liter (Metric Volume)

Introduction : The liter is the fundamental metric unit for measuring liquid volume, equal to 1 cubic decimeter. It's widely used worldwide for everyday measurements of liquids and some dry goods, offering a practical middle ground between milliliters and cubic meters.

History & Origin : Originated in France during the metric system's creation in 1795 as a 'cadil'. Redefined in 1964 to exactly 1 cubic decimeter. The spelling 'liter' is American, while 'litre' is used in most English-speaking countries.

Current Use : Standard for beverage containers, fuel economy (liters per 100km), and cooking measurements outside the US. Used in science for approximate measurements where extreme precision isn't required.
